How are black bean soup and creamy Shrimp Soup different?
- Black bean soup is richer in fiber, copper, folate, iron, manganese, phosphorus, and vitamin A, while creamy Shrimp Soup is higher in vitamin B12.
- Black bean soup covers your daily need for fiber, 26% more than creamy Shrimp Soup.
- Black bean soup contains 22 times more folate than creamy Shrimp Soup. Black bean soup contains 66µg of folate, while creamy Shrimp Soup contains 3µg.
- Creamy Shrimp Soup is lower in sodium.
Soup, black bean, canned, condensed and Soup, cream of shrimp, canned, condensed types were used in this article.
